Overview of Physics Krane Wiley
Kenneth S. Krane’s "Modern Physics" is a staple textbook that tackles the core topics of
modern physics, including relativity, quantum mechanics, atomic structure, nuclear
physics, and particle physics. Published by Wiley, a leading academic publisher, the book
is often lauded for its clarity and depth. Unlike introductory texts that prioritize conceptual
understanding at the expense of mathematical rigor, Krane’s approach balances
qualitative explanations with quantitative analysis, making it suitable for physics majors
who are preparing for advanced study or research.
The book’s structure is methodical, beginning with the philosophical and experimental
foundations of modern physics and gradually progressing to more complex theories and
applications. This pedagogical strategy aids students in building a coherent mental model
of the physical world from classical roots to quantum phenomena. Importantly, Krane’s
textbook integrates historical context, experimental evidence, and mathematical
derivations, which enrich the learning experience by connecting abstract theory to
practical discoveries.
Core Topics and Content Depth
Physics Krane Wiley covers several core areas of modern physics comprehensively:
Special Relativity: The text introduces Einstein’s theory with an emphasis on
1.
Lorentz transformations, time dilation, and relativistic energy and momentum,
providing derivations and problem-solving techniques.
Quantum Mechanics: It presents the fundamental principles of wave mechanics,
2.
the Schrödinger equation, quantum states, and operators, often comparing classical
and quantum views to highlight conceptual shifts.
Atomic and Molecular Physics: Krane delves into atomic models, electron
3.
configurations, and spectroscopy, tying these to experimental methods and real-
world applications.
Nuclear Physics: The book explores nuclear structure, radioactivity, nuclear
4.
reactions, and applications in energy and medicine, emphasizing both theoretical
frameworks and experimental findings.
Particle Physics and Cosmology: Although less extensive, the textbook touches
5.
upon fundamental particles, interactions, and the early universe, providing a
glimpse into frontier physics topics.
This broad scope, combined with rigorous mathematical treatment, makes Krane’s text a
versatile resource for students and educators seeking a well-rounded modern physics
education.
Comparative Analysis: Physics Krane Wiley Versus Other Modern
Physics Textbooks
When compared to other popular modern physics textbooks such as "Introduction to
Modern Physics" by Serway, Moses, and Moyer, or "Modern Physics for Scientists and
Engineers" by Thornton and Rex, Krane’s book distinguishes itself through its balance of
theory and application. While some texts lean heavily on conceptual explanations or
pedagogical simplicity, Krane maintains a level of sophistication suitable for students with
strong mathematical backgrounds.
Additionally, the Wiley edition is known for its clear diagrams, problem sets, and
appendices that supplement the main text with useful mathematical tools. The problem
sets are varied in difficulty, encouraging both procedural practice and critical thinking.
This contrasts with some competitors that might focus more narrowly on introductory-
level problems.
However, some critics note that Krane’s text can be dense for students without prior
exposure to advanced calculus and linear algebra. The textbook assumes a certain level
of mathematical maturity, which may limit its accessibility for a broader audience.
Nevertheless, for physics majors aiming to deepen their understanding, this rigor is often
seen as a strength rather than a drawback.
